19 redshirt leaders surrender to acknowledge charge

BANGKOK: -- Nineteen redshirt leaders and members today reported to the Crime Suppression Division (CSD) police to acknowledge charge of defying the military junta's order.

The redshirt leaders and members, all in black T-shirts, were led by Jatuporn Phromphan, president of the United Front for Democracy against Dictatorship (UDD).

They were charged for defying the order of the National Council for Peace and Order (NCPO) banning political assembly of more than five people after they held a press conference at the former Imperial Lard Prao shopping centre to declare the establishment of their own anti referendum cheat centre.

Jatuporn said he was relieved after the government did not invoke Section 44 of the interim charter to detain them same as those detained for distorting the draft charter.

However he warned that he and all colleagues would stage a fast if they are mistreated or Section 44 is used to detain them.

Source: http://englishnews.thaipbs.or.th/19-redshirt-leaders-surrender-acknowledge-charge/

-- Thai PBS 2016-08-02
